How many power projects are there in Tamil Nadu?

The company operates four large thermal power stations: Ennore Thermal Power Station (ETPS) – 450 MW (2×60, 3×110 MW) Mettur Thermal Power Station (MTPS) – 1440 MW (4×210, 1×600 MW) North Chennai Thermal Power Station (NCTPS) 1830 MW (3×210 MW, 2×600 MW)

Which is the biggest power plant in Tamilnadu?

The North Chennai Thermal Power Station is a power station situated about 25 kilometres (16 mi) from Chennai city. It is one of the major power plants of Tamil Nadu and has a total installed capacity of 1,830 MW (2,450,000 hp).

What is meant by Tantransco?

The Tamil Nadu Transmission Corporation Limited (TANTRANSCO) (Tamil: தமிழ்நாடு மின் தொடரமைப்புக் கழகம் (வரையறுக்கப்பட்டது)) is an electric power transmission system operator owned by Government of Tamil Nadu. It was established in November 2010, as a result of restructuring the Tamil Nadu Electricity Board.

When did Tamilnadu get electricity?

1st July 1957
The Tamil Nadu Electricity Board was constituted with effect from 1st July 1957 under the Electricity Supply Act 1948 and came to be known as “The Madras State Electricity Board” with Padmashri V.P. Appadurai appointed as Chief Engineer (Electricity).

Which nuclear power station in India is located in Tamil Nadu?

Kalpakkam is located on the east coast about 70 km south of Chennai in Tamil Nadu State. The Madras Atomic Power Station (MAPS) having two units of 220 MW was established in 1983-85 by Nuclear Power Corporation of India Ltd (NPCIL).
